sale prams are specifically designed for babies, predominantly those aged 0 to 6 months. They generally feature a fully reclining seat, enabling the baby to lie flat comfortably, which is important for their spinal column development. In addition, prams typically include a carrycot accessory, supplying a safe, comfortable environment for newborns.
Benefits of Prams:Support for Newborns: The flat style appropriates for young infants.Comfortable for Sleeping: Full recline supports much better sleep.Stylish Design: Many moms and dads select cheap prams for their aesthetic appeal.Factors to consider:Prams can be bulkier, making them less perfect for mass transit or tight spaces.They require additional devices, such as rain covers and sunshades.Pushchairs: Versatile and Practical
Pushchairs (or strollers) serve a broader age range, accommodating children from infancy to young children, generally as much as 4 years. They come with a number of recline choices, allowing moms and dads to choose the best position depending upon their kid's age and requirements.
